DESCRIPTION:WorkSafeBC-Approved Transportation Endorsement Training \nJoin our Transportation Endorsement (TE) training in Coquitlam\, BC. This course delivers essential skills and certification for workplace and regulatory requirements. \n\nCourse Overview\nThe Transportation Endorsement (TE) course provides first aid attendants with the specialized knowledge and practical skills required to safely package\, monitor\, and transport injured or ill workers to medical facilities when emergency services may be delayed. This endorsement is required by WorkSafeBC when first aid attendants are responsible for patient transport. \nCourse Dates & Schedule\nPrimary Course\n\nDates: –April 16\, 2026\nTime: 8:30am – 4:30pm\n\nLocation\n914 sherwood Ave \nCourse Fees\n\nCourse: $128\n\nWho Should Take This Course?\nFirst aid attendants holding a valid Basic\, Intermediate\, or Advanced First Aid certificate who are required to transport injured workers Designated workplace first aid attendants in moderate- to high-risk environments Safety officers\, supervisors\, and emergency response coordinators Workers in construction\, industrial\, manufacturing\, forestry\, and remote worksites Anyone required by WorkSafeBC to provide patient transportation as part of their role \nWhat You Will Learn\nSafe patient packaging and positioning for transport Spinal motion restriction and patient immobilization techniques Proper use of stretchers\, spine boards\, and transport equipment Lifting and moving patients safely as a team Transport considerations for conscious and unconscious patients Monitoring patient condition during transport Communication and coordination with emergency medical services Documentation and handover procedures \nCertification\nUpon successful completion\, participants receive a Transportation Endorsement (TE) certificate valid for 3 years\, provided they maintain a current WorkSafeBC first aid certificate. \nPrerequisites\nValid Basic\, Intermediate\, or Advanced First Aid certificate (formerly OFA 1\, OFA 2\, or OFA 3) Government-issued photo ID Physically capable of participating in hands-on lifting and transport scenarios \nLanguage\nThis course is taught in English. \nWhat to Bring\n\nGovernment-issued ID\nComfortable and movable clothing\nSnacks / lunch\nNotebook & pen\n\nFrequently Asked Questions\nIs Transportation Endorsement required if I already have first aid? Yes. Transportation Endorsement is required when a first aid attendant is responsible for transporting injured workers to medical facilities. How long is the Transportation Endorsement valid? The TE certificate is valid for 3 years\, as long as your underlying first aid certificate remains current. Can I take TE without a first aid certificate? No. A valid WorkSafeBC first aid certificate is required to receive Transportation Endorsement certification. DESCRIPTION: Red Cross Basic Life Support (BLS) certification is a globally recognized program developed for healthcare professionals (HCPs)\, emergency responders\, and first aid providers. It equips participants with the critical skills required during life-threatening medical emergencies.\n\n\nAt Metro Safety\, we follow the latest Canadian Red Cross guidelines to deliver practical\, hands-on training that aligns with both national and WorkSafeBC standards. \nUnlike standard CPR courses\, BLS focuses on high-performance resuscitation techniques\, team-based emergency response\, and the effective use of Automated External Defibrillators (AEDs). \nWhether you’re a nurse\, firefighter\, paramedic\, or health sciences student\, this training helps you respond quickly and confidently to cardiac arrest\, blocked airways\, and respiratory crises.
